Robotics as a Service (RaaS) is a business model that offers robotic solutions on a subscription or lease basis rather than requiring a large, upfront capital expenditure on robotic hardware and software. This service-based approach facilitates the adoption of robotic technologies across various industries, enabling businesses to deploy robotic solutions in a more cost-effective, scalable, and flexible manner.

Here’s an overview of (RaaS) Robotics as a Service:

1. Flexibility and Scalability:

  • Adaptive Usage: Companies can scale up or down based on their current requirements without significant capital investments.
  • Trial and Experimentation: RaaS enables businesses to test and experiment with robotics solutions without committing to long-term ownership.

2. Cost Efficiency:

  • Reduced Initial Investment: Lower upfront costs compared to purchasing robots outright.
  • Predictable Expenses: Subscription-based pricing or pay-as-you-go models make expenses predictable and manageable.

3. Maintenance and Support:

  • Continuous Maintenance: The RaaS provider typically handles maintenance, ensuring that robots are always in operational condition.
  • Technical Support: Ongoing support for troubleshooting and optimization.

4. Advanced Technologies and Upgrades:

  • Regular Upgrades: Access to the latest robotics technologies without the need for purchasing new hardware.
  • Integration with AI and Cloud: Many RaaS solutions are integrated with artificial intelligence, cloud computing, and data analytics for enhanced functionality.

5. Applications Across Industries:

  • Warehouse Automation: Automating tasks such as picking, packing, and inventory management.
  • Healthcare: Robots assisting in surgeries, patient care, or sanitation.
  • Agriculture: Robots used for tasks like harvesting, planting, or monitoring.
  • Retail: Robots for inventory management, customer assistance, or delivery.
  • Security: Surveillance robots that patrol and monitor designated areas.

6. Ease of Implementation:

  • Quick Deployment: Faster deployment times compared to traditional robotics implementation.
  • Custom Solutions: RaaS providers can offer solutions tailored to specific industry needs or challenges.

7. Data and Analytics:

  • Performance Monitoring: Real-time monitoring of robotic performance and operations.
  • Insights and Optimization: Analytical insights derived from robotic operations to drive process improvement.

8. Regulatory and Compliance:

  • Standardized Compliance: RaaS providers can ensure that their robotic solutions adhere to industry-specific regulations.
  • Security Protocols: Data security and privacy measures in place to protect sensitive information.

9. Training and Knowledge Transfer:

  • User Training: RaaS providers often offer training to ensure end-users can effectively work with and manage the robots.
  • Knowledge Base Access: Access to resources, best practices, and community discussions related to robotics.

10. Collaborative Robotics:

  • Cobots: Many RaaS solutions involve collaborative robots (cobots) designed to work safely alongside humans in shared spaces.

Robotics as a Service (RaaS) is a strategic solution for businesses looking to leverage the benefits of robotics without the challenges of ownership, maintenance, and technology obsolescence. By converting large capital expenses into manageable operational expenses, RaaS makes robotic technology accessible to a broader range of businesses and applications.
